Fel-Pro 3060 Karropak: Best Overall Performer

For most small-engine repairs, Karropak serves as the gold standard of versatility. This fiber-based material is treated to resist common fuels, oils, and coolants, making it the perfect “do-it-all” sheet to keep in the workshop drawer. It offers excellent bolt-torque retention, which is vital when working on vintage aluminum or cast-iron engine housings that have seen decades of heat cycles.

While it lacks the extreme heat resistance of high-end specialized materials, it handles standard engine operating temperatures with ease. It cuts cleanly with a sharp pair of shears or a hobby knife, leaving crisp edges that won’t fray or delaminate. This material is the logical first choice for anyone looking to stock one sheet that solves 90% of shop problems.

Victor Reinz AFM 30: Top High-Temperature Pick

When dealing with high-performance engines or components prone to intense heat soak, such as exhaust manifolds or cylinder heads, AFM 30 is the professional’s choice. This is an aramid-fiber reinforced gasket material designed specifically for applications where standard paper would turn brittle and crumble. It offers superior recovery, meaning it maintains a tight seal even as metal components expand and contract under thermal stress.

The material is tougher to cut than traditional gasket paper, often requiring a sharp punch set or a fresh utility blade for precision. Despite the extra effort required to fabricate a shape, the peace of mind provided by its heat-soak resistance is unmatched. This material is mandatory for anyone working on equipment pushed to its limit or vintage engines that run notoriously hot.

Fel-Pro 3157 Rubber-Fiber: Best for Oil & Fuel

If a piece of equipment has developed a persistent seep, the Fel-Pro 3157 is likely the cure. By embedding synthetic rubber particles within a fiber matrix, this material creates a seal that actually swells slightly when it comes into contact with oils and fuels. This unique property ensures that the gasket effectively “self-seals” once the engine warms up and fluids begin to circulate.

Because of this swelling action, it is essential to ensure the mating surfaces are perfectly clean and flat to avoid over-tightening. It is arguably the best material for sealing oil pans, side covers, and transmission cases where fluid migration is a constant threat. If the goal is to stop a leak once and for all on a vintage machine, this is the material to reach for first.

Fel-Pro 3137 Cork-Lam: For Uneven Mating Surfaces

Vintage cast-metal parts often suffer from pitting, warping, or deep scratches that prevent a standard flat paper gasket from sealing correctly. The Fel-Pro 3137 Cork-Lam combines a rubberized core with natural cork to bridge these surface imperfections with ease. The cork provides a high-friction, compressible layer that fills gaps that would otherwise cause a vacuum or fluid leak.

Working with cork requires a gentle hand, as the material can crack if folded sharply or handled roughly. It is best used for valve covers and oil pans where the metal-to-metal seal is less than perfect. If a piece of equipment is showing its age with pitted mating surfaces, this is the most reliable way to achieve a seal without machining the components.

Choosing the Right Gasket Material for Your Job

Selecting the correct material requires assessing the “big three” factors: temperature, pressure, and fluid contact. A paper-based gasket will fail instantly in an exhaust application, while a rigid high-heat material may not seal a pitted water pump cover. Always check if the part contacts oil, coolant, or gasoline, as some materials will degrade rapidly when exposed to the wrong medium.

Consider the rigidity of the components as well. If the flanges are thin and prone to bowing, a thicker, more compressible material like cork-lam is necessary to distribute the clamping force evenly. If the surfaces are stout and machined flat, a thinner fiber material will provide a more stable and permanent seal.

How to Scribe and Cut a Perfect Custom Gasket

Precision in fabrication starts with the layout, not the cutting. Place the gasket material over the part, then use a ball-peen hammer to gently tap along the edges of the metal flange; the sharp edges will naturally “punch” the paper to create a perfect outline of the bolt holes and fluid ports. This technique is far more accurate than trying to trace with a pencil or marker.

When cutting, prioritize slow, deliberate movements. Use a sharp hobby knife for internal holes and heavy-duty shears for the outer perimeter. Never force the blade through the material, as this leads to jagged edges that will inevitably create a leak path. A slow cut is a clean cut, and a clean cut is the difference between a dry engine and a messy garage floor.

Proper Surface Prep for a Reliable, Leak-Proof Seal

A high-quality gasket will fail if it is placed on a dirty or oily surface. Before installing any new gasket, scrape the mating faces clean using a plastic or brass scraper to avoid gouging the soft metal surfaces of vintage equipment. Finish the prep by wiping the faces down with an evaporating solvent like brake cleaner to remove any remaining oil film.

Even a microscopic layer of old gasket residue can prevent a new gasket from seating fully. Take the time to ensure the bolt holes are also free of debris, as packed grease can interfere with proper bolt torque. Taking an extra ten minutes to prep the surfaces ensures the new gasket performs as intended for years to come.

Should You Use Sealant with a New Paper Gasket?

A common misconception is that adding a bead of silicone or gasket maker improves a paper seal. In reality, modern gasket materials are designed to work dry; adding a slippery sealant often causes the gasket to squirm out of position or extrude under bolt pressure. Use a thin coat of contact adhesive only if you need to hold the gasket in place during the assembly of a difficult or overhead component.

The only exception is when dealing with surfaces that are slightly pitted or uneven. In those rare cases, a very light, uniform smear of a dedicated gasket dressing can help fill microscopic voids. If the gasket requires a heavy bead of RTV silicone to stop a leak, the underlying issue is likely a warped housing or poor surface preparation, not the gasket material itself.
